In current scenario, conventional non-renewable sources of energy like coal, uranium, diesel etc. are depleting day by day because of their limited availability in nature. And our demand for electricity is increasing year by year. Therefore, there is need to shift our usage at renewable sources of energy that can meet our increasing load demand and are environmentally friendly. Three phase grid connected inverter is used as an interface between DG sources like solar and grid. Filter acts as interfacing element between them. Design of filter is crucial because stability of power system largely depends on it. LCL filter being a third order filter provides better attenuation of inverter switching harmonics than L and LC filter. LCL filter is having many advantages but there is a possibility of resonance of LCL filter with the grid. This may cause stability problems in power system. Passive damping techniques is proposed in this paper to reduce resonance peak at resonant frequency. Simulations results are shown to verify the performance of passive damping technique used.
